Admission Requirements for this Program
|
Direct Admit: 2016 New Freshmen
Admitted to USU in Good Standing
- Top 10% of high school class
- 3.7+ High School GPA
- 28+ ACT/1250+ SAT score
- 3.5+ High School GPA AND 24+ ACT/1090+ SAT score
- Accounting majors: 3.6+ High School GPA and 26+ ACT/1170+ SAT

Freshmen prior to Fall 2016: Transfer students from other institutions or other programs at USU
Option 1:
24+ post-high school credits
3.5+ overall GPA
Complete the Change of Matriculation Form
Option 2:
Complete the Huntsman School Admissions Application.
|
Freshmen Fall 2016
24+ post-high school credits
The following courses with a C or higher.
- MGT 1050
- ACCT 2010
- ECON 1500
- MIS 2100
- STAT 2300 or STAT 2000
- ENGL 2010
2.75 overall GPA (3.0 GPA and B or better in ACCT 2010 for Accounting majors)
Complete the Huntsman School Admissions Application.

The Huntsman School of Business adheres to the USU repeat policy in the following manner: a student is limited to 10 repeats total to earn a degree from Utah State University.
-
The Huntsman School of Business restricts the number a specific course can be taken as follows: students may take a business course twice (once, plus one repeat). Beyond two attempts, the student’s dean must approve additional registration for the class.
